Compact magneto-optical disk head using reflection polarizing holographic optical element

Abstract

In an optical data storage system, a small-size and light weight optical head is required for high speed track access. A holographic optical element(HOE), which can be combined with focusing error detecting function, tracking error detecting function and beam splitting function, has high potential to realize a small size optical head1). To enable applying the HOE for a magneto-optical(MO) head, it is required that the HOE possesses polarizing characteristics in the HOE's beam splitting function2). For this requirement the authors have developed an MO head using reflection polarizing HOE(R-PHOE). This paper describes the design for the R-PHOE, optical head configuration, fabrication of the R-PHOE and head operation characteristics.
